Occupations Humans Will Always Dominate
While artificial intelligence rapidly advances at an astonishing pace, there are certain jobs that remain firmly in the realm of human expertise. These tasks require a unique blend of creativity, compassion, and critical thinking that AI simply cannot replicate.
- For instance artistic careers such as painting, writing, and music composition. These require a deep understanding of human emotions and experiences, which is something AI currently lacks.
- In the medical sector, AI can assist with tasks like analyzing illnesses, but it cannot substitute for the human touch necessary for patient care and support.
- Likewise, teaching involves a profound relationship with students, responsiveness to individual needs, and the ability to inspire and motivate.
Moreover, jobs that require complex problem-solving in dynamic situations, such as emergency response or crisis management, will continue to rely on human insight. While AI can be a valuable tool, it cannot fully grasp the nuances and complexities of these difficult situations.
